Known for forging wife Maud's artwork, Everett Lewis's originals up for auction
February 8, 2025
An Ontario auction house expects some original art made by Everett Lewis, the husband of famed Nova Scotia artist Maud Lewis, could sell in an auction ending Sunday for as much as $5,000 a painting. It's a figure that, depending on who you ask, can be attributed to Maud's fame or the quality of Everett's work.
